Abstract

A locally synchronous circuit module has a delay circuit having and input and output coupled to a clock input. The delay circuit provides a delay which when incorporated in a clock oscillator ensures a clock period that is at least as long as needed to transfer information between the storage elements. A handshake circuit is provided for generating handshake signals for timing information transfer between the locally synchronous circuit module and a further circuit. The handshake circuit comprises the delay circuit, so that at least part of the handshake signals during a handshake transaction are timed by traveling through the delay circuit and are applied to the clock input to clock the locally synchronous circuit module.
